What purpose do you use UV leds for? if for just making things glow, 365nm is the one you want, if you use it to cure UV resin or glue, 400nm is a better choice, 365 will also work, but not as good. I noticed uv glue that i cure with 365 hardens but still feels sticky a bit, but the same glue cures faster with 400nm and leaves the surface completely dry,

The issue is, it’d need to be dual channel, because with both on at once, the white is just going to drown out any fluorescence from the UV. It is doable as a mule, it just needs to be 2 LEDs of each because there is only a dual channel MCPCB for 4 LEDs, unless you were getting a custom board. I’ve not seen one personally, but there’s no reason it wouldn’t work I can think of, try asking Hank if he can make a dual channel mule with the normal 4 LED dual PCB.
Also, you couldn’t have a ZWB filter, so are going to get blue and violet off the UV emitters.

I wonder why they fail so quick. Unlike white leds, color leds, as well as uv are more sensitive to overheat, so the same heathsink capacity that works fine with white leds, will not be adequate for uv leds, it may work a bit, but if driven beyond heat removing capacity of the host that uv led requires, it will fail soon.
